I cannot guarantee my plans to increase my IQ will work, but I think it's worth a shot. Good IQ tests measure a variety of facets, such as verbal intelligence, fluid intelligence, quantitative intelligence, memory, visual-spatial intelligence, and processing speed, to derive a full-scale IQ. Theoretically, then, improving each one of the facets gradually should lead to an overall increase in full-scale IQ over a long period. You should be realistic with your IQ gains and aim for 5-10 points at most, as that would probably be your genetic limit.

My Plan:
  • Verbal Intelligence:
    • Memorize a set amount of vocabulary words to remember each day.
    • Read philosophical and political books that use abstract language.
    • Just continue to pursue learning in your free time, whether that be through podcasts, documentaries, or even looking at Twitter, to increase your overall knowledge, which increases crystallized intelligence.

  • Quantitative Intelligence:
    • Learn how to solve math problems from the International Math Olympiad.
    • Get a math textbook to learn college-level math content such as Linear Algebra.
    • Brush up on math knowledge, especially in areas that I am weak in.

  • Fluid Intelligence:
    • Image Streaming.
    • Take a course in logic to understand the relationship between different concepts and how they relate to our world.
    • Take a course in computer science to foster problem-solving skills.

  • Working Memory/Processing Speed
    • Learn how to use mnemonic devices to comprehend large sums of content.
    • Learn how to speed read to increase processing speed.

Other Things I Plan to Do:
  • Eat Well, Sleep Earlier, Exercise More, Socialize to Improve Mental Health.
  • Meditate to clear your mind.
  • Nootropics when I'm older to maximize brain power.
  • Playing Chess or Word Games.

By increasing your intelligence, you will make better decisions to plan for the future and live a more fulfilling and healthier life.
